What to Consider in a Moving Plan

Now that we know why a moving plan is important, let's talk about what should be included in it.

Inspection

Before you start moving the stairs, you need to do a thorough inspection. Check for any loose parts, damage, or signs of wear and tear. This way, you can address any issues before the move and avoid further problems.

Disassembly (if necessary)

In some cases, it might be easier to move the stairs if they're disassembled. If this is the case, your moving plan should include instructions on how to safely take the stairs apart. Make sure to label all the parts so that you can easily put them back together later.

Transport

You need to think about how you're going to transport the stairs. Will you use a truck? If so, what size truck do you need? You also need to consider how the stairs will be secured in the truck to prevent them from moving around during transit.

Installation at the New Location

Once the stairs are at their new location, you need to have a plan for installing them. This might involve leveling the ground, attaching the stairs to the appropriate structure, and making sure everything is secure.
